  • Final cut pro x is killing my macbook pro!

    Final cut pro x running on my macbook pro results in constant running of fans at full pace. Jerkiness in playback on fcpx. Entire computer is jerky through other programs like safari too. It seems fcpx background operations are absorbing the entire power of the co puter. Any thoughts/suggestions? Ps it runs fcp 7 fine.

    With your MacBook Pro, did you get a unit with the dual video processor? A while ago Apple started putting in two different video cards. One was for the mundane everyday stuff and the goal was to save power. On my MBP I have a Nvidia GeForce 9400M, I also have an Nvidia GeForce 9600M GT which is much more robust for graphics power. The VRAM on the 9400 was only 256, with the 9600M GT it was 512. The bigger the GPU and the fast the GPU, the faster the MBP especially with FCP.
    You can select the faster processor by going to system preferences and choose higher performance. It will require you to log out and log back in to use the different GPU. Also turn your harddrive to never sleep when you do this and you will see some improvement in speed and lag.
    Another thing is to set up your projects on a fast external drive. If you try to keep source files and project files on the MBP drive you are begging for slowness.

  • I have Final cut Pro HD sequence and I need to burn this on a DVD

    I have Final cut Pro HD sequence and I need to burn this on a DVD, my sequence lasts 1 hr and 33 minutes. What are my options? Is it better to export as a Quick Time movie or using the compressor? I'm new to the compressor just learning, please help.

    Select your sequence in the browser window, go to the File menu and choose Export Using Compressor.
    When compressor opens, choose the DVD best quality settings, 120 minutes.
    For audio and video both, choose both the m2v video and the AC3 audio. (Dolby Professional)
    Choose a destination for your files, and hit submit.
    When it's finished, import these files into your DVD SP project, and make your DVD.
    Be sure to choose the 16:9 anamorphic settings.

  • Final Cut Pro 4.5 and Quicktime 7 compatibility issues. Error 39!

    I see some people saying Quicktime 7 is not compatible with Final Cut 4.5 and some saying it is.
    I upgraded to 10.3.9 and then Quicktime 7 and I started getting error 39 at this one spot in my timeline and then crashing if I tried to play just a few seconds ahead of that spot. I tried trashing the prefs but that didn't do any good. The individual files play fine outside the timeline so it isn't corrupt media. I tried rerendering the effects that are at that point but that didn't help. I tried copying the entire timeline to a new sequence and that didn't help.
    The strange thing was that when I took the part of the movie that was having trouble and deleted it from the timeline it still got error 39 when just playing over the empty timeline where the media used to be! This led me to realize that the problem lay in some Quicktime audio effects I had about a second in front ot the error 39 spot. I took off the effects from that audio but it didn't help. Then I deleted that audio from the timeline and just pasted it back in from the original clip and then it finally got to working.
    Now I know nothing about the software, but I thought there might be some connection between the fact that I had effects that FCP labels as "quicktime effects" on there from my days in Quicktime 6.5, then upgraded to Q7, and perhaps those old effects don't work in Q7? I don't know.
    So, my immediate problem is solved but I thought this experience may be of use to someone else. And perhaps some compatibility issues can be brought to light.

    #29: Need AGP Graphics card
    Shane's Stock Answer #29 – Error: “Need AGP Graphics card”
    http://docs.info.apple.com/article.html?artnum=302667
    The Final Cut software is looking for a graphics card type that is required for that version of the software. FCP 4 and FCP 4.5 were released when AGP cards were the requirement. Attempting to open this on a Mac with a PCIe graphics card, such as an Intel Mac, will cause this error. FCP 4.5 is not supported on the Intel Macs. If you happen to have a PowerPC Quad processor Mac and get this error, you can try this hack:
    http://www.xlr8yourmac.com/feedback/finalcut_pro_on_oldmacs.html
    You can also press the "esc" key as you launch FCP. This enables FCP to open and run, but know that it might not work optimally.
    If that doesn’t work, or if you have an Intel Mac, you are going to have to upgrade to a supported version of FCP…and FCP 6, part of Final Cut Studio 2, is the latest version.

  • Looks like final cut pro does run and "runs well" on macbook

    http://www.creativemac.com/articles/viewarticle.jsp?id=43717
    "Contrary to the bizarre rumor, the MacBook can indeed run Final Cut Pro, and it can run it quite well, if these tests are any indication. For Final Cut Pro, we ran four individual tests to compare performance on a variety of functions and in both HD and SD. In most cases, the results were fairly close. The 13-inch MacBook beat the dual G5 in two of four tests, tied it in one and lost out by one second in another. All of the tests were rendering tests, which, of course, doesn't tell the whole story. But it does give a good indication of the power of a computer's CPU."

    Final Cut Pro while it does run it is not supported to do so.
    Please be aware also that the report only tested functionality that is not impacted by the GPU. For instance, the MacBook will more than likely fall flat on its face, comparitively, when faced with real time effects. Using FCP is not only about rendering and encoding speeds. There are other hours, day, weeks etc infornt of FCP that does not involve neither rendering or encoding.
    It is a skewed report that does not taking into the account the actual "using" of FCP.
    As a cheap alternative to an MBP for portability reasons… the MB will be fantastic.
